Eminem: The Rap God and His Little Girl
Before we delve into the song, let's talk about Eminem and his daughter, Hailie Jade Scott Mathers. Born in 1995, Hailie has been a constant source of inspiration for her father's music. Eminem's life as a single parent has significantly influenced his lyrics, often weaving stories about his love and dedication to his daughter.
Eminem has always been open about the challenges he's faced, both personally and professionally. Through it all, his love for Hailie has remained a steadfast beacon, guiding him through the storms. This deep, profound bond is beautifully reflected in many of his songs, including "Not Afraid".
"Not Afraid": A Father's Love Letter
"Not Afraid" is a powerful track from Eminem's 2010 album, Recovery. It's an anthem of resilience, courage, and unconditional love. The song is a testament to Eminem's personal growth and his commitment to being the best father he can be.
The Inspiration Behind "Not Afraid"
Eminem has openly discussed how his struggles with addiction and personal demons led him to write "Not Afraid". The song is a reflection of his journey towards sobriety and his determination to be a better role model for Hailie. Hailie Jade: Eminem's Little Girl, All Grown Up
As we've been exploring Eminem and his daughter, it's worth noting that Hailie Jade has grown into a remarkable young woman. She's a graduate of Michigan State University and has dipped her toes into the world of social media, sharing glimpses of her life with her followers.
